Figure pour l’abrégé : Figure 3The present invention relates to a method and a device for stopping a moving vehicle. If the non-zero speed of the vehicle and the absence of pressure from at least one hand of the driver on the steering wheel are detected simultaneously for at least a first predetermined duration, triggering (521) of a time countdown and triggering (522 ) an alert inside the vehicle; at the end of said time countdown, if the speed of the vehicle has not been reduced by a determined number of kilometers per hour and if no pressure has been applied to the steering wheel for a second determined period, one or more actions are implemented to immobilize and secure the vehicle. A notification is sent to the driver to inform him of the state of the vehicle and the geographical position of the vehicle. Figure for abstract: Figure 3
